The short version

Pendleton is wealthier than most US places, with a median household income of $73,750. Population has grown 17% since 2019. 0%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, below the national rate of 33%. Households here earn about 29% more than the Missouri median.

Frequently asked

How many people live in Pendleton, Missouri?

Pendleton, Missouri has about 34 residents according to the 2020 American Community Survey.

What is the median household income in Pendleton, Missouri?

The typical household in Pendleton, Missouri earns about $73,750 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

How educated are people in Pendleton, Missouri?

About 0.0% of adults age 25 and over in Pendleton, Missouri h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in Pendleton, Missouri?

About 6.5% of people in Pendleton, Missouri live below the federal poverty line.
